Adiós Margaritas Baratas: Cactus Discontinues Happy Hour at Madison Location

Call some place paradise, kiss it goodbye. Cactus Madison Park discontinues happy hour.
Cactus has one of my favorite happy hours in the city, so I was bummed to learn that the restaurant decided to cancel happy hour at the Madison Park location. I called up owner Bret Chatalas, who told me the location struggled with the logistics of happy hour due to a tiny bar area that flows right into the dining room. “We had a lot of issues this summer,” said Chatalas, who waited until after the busy season to shut the discounts down. One problem was that dining room customers would get wind of drink specials next door in the bar, then wonder why their margaritas weren’t discounted. “We were upsetting people more than making them happy,” he told me.
This isn’t the first time we’ve seen restaurants with limited or no bar space struggle with the whole happy hour endeavor. I keep going back to Olivar to see if they’ve figured it out; an awkward encounter always awaits.
Chatalas said all of the food items on the HH menu are still available, just in larger size at steeper prices. We’ll especially miss the smoked chicken quesadilla—just perfect snack-size and at $5, rather too much at Frisbee-size and $10.
